备份数据库有什么用

worktile 其他 6

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    备份数据库是将数据库中的数据和结构进行复制和存储的过程。备份数据库有以下几个重要的用途:

    1. 数据丢失恢复:备份数据库可以帮助恢复在数据库中意外删除或损坏的数据。如果数据库发生故障,如硬件故障、网络问题、软件错误等,备份数据库可以用来恢复数据,确保业务的连续性。

    2. 业务连续性:备份数据库可以确保在灾难事件发生时,例如自然灾害、黑客攻击等,数据可以被快速恢复,使业务能够继续运行。备份数据库也可以用于迁移或升级数据库系统,以确保业务的平稳过渡。

    3. 数据分析和报告:备份数据库可以用于数据分析和生成报告。备份数据库提供了一个静态的数据集,可以用于生成各种报表、图表和数据分析,为决策者提供准确和全面的数据支持。

    4. 合规性和法律要求:备份数据库可以帮助组织满足合规性和法律要求。根据一些行业的规定,如金融、医疗等,组织需要保留历史数据以供审计和法律调查使用。备份数据库可以满足这些要求,确保数据的完整性和可追溯性。

    5. 数据库恢复测试:备份数据库可以用于进行数据库恢复测试。在备份数据库中进行恢复测试可以帮助评估数据库恢复的性能和可靠性,以及恢复所需的时间和资源。这样可以帮助组织优化备份和恢复策略,提高数据库的可用性和可靠性。

    总之,备份数据库是一项重要的数据库管理任务,它可以保护和恢复数据,确保业务的连续性和数据的完整性。此外,备份数据库还可以用于数据分析、合规性和法律要求的满足,以及数据库恢复测试的评估和优化。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    数据库备份是指将数据库中的数据、表结构、索引等信息进行复制,并存储到另一个地方,以防止数据丢失或损坏。数据库备份具有以下几个重要的作用:

    1. 数据恢复:数据库备份是最常见、最重要的目的之一。在数据库发生故障或数据丢失的情况下,可以通过备份文件恢复数据库,使得数据能够重新回到正常的状态。

    2. 防止数据丢失:数据库备份可以保护数据库中的数据免受硬件故障、软件错误、人为错误、病毒攻击等因素的影响。如果没有备份,一旦出现数据丢失,将无法恢复,可能导致重要数据的永久丢失。

    3. 容灾备份:数据库备份还可以用于容灾恢复。在自然灾害、火灾、地震等突发事件中,备份文件可以保证数据的安全,并能在另一个地方进行恢复,确保业务的连续性。

    4. 数据迁移:数据库备份也常用于数据迁移的过程中。当需要将数据库从一个环境迁移到另一个环境时,可以先进行备份,然后将备份文件导入到目标环境中,从而完成数据的迁移。

    5. 数据分析和测试:备份数据库可以提供一个独立的环境,供数据分析和测试使用。在进行复杂的数据分析、性能测试、功能测试等工作时,备份数据库可以作为一个独立的副本,不会影响到生产环境的数据。

    总之,数据库备份是保护数据安全的重要手段,它可以在数据发生故障或丢失时进行数据恢复,同时也可以用于容灾备份、数据迁移、数据分析和测试等多种用途。通过定期进行数据库备份,可以最大程度地保护数据库中的数据免受各种风险的影响。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    备份数据库是指将数据库中的数据和结构复制到另一个位置,以防止数据丢失或意外删除。备份数据库有以下几个用途:

    1. 数据恢复:当数据库发生故障、数据丢失或被误删时,可以通过备份文件还原数据库,恢复数据到最近的备份状态。

    2. 数据迁移:在数据库迁移过程中,可以通过备份数据库将数据从一个环境迁移到另一个环境,确保数据的完整性和一致性。

    3. 数据安全:备份数据库可以作为一种数据安全的措施,以防止数据被黑客攻击、病毒感染或其他安全漏洞导致的数据损坏。

    4. 灾难恢复:当发生自然灾害、电力故障或硬件损坏等情况时,备份数据库可以用于恢复数据,以减少业务中断时间和数据丢失。

    5. 测试和开发:备份数据库可以用于测试和开发环境,以便在不影响生产环境的情况下进行测试、开发和调试。

    下面将详细介绍备份数据库的方法和操作流程。

    一、备份数据库的方法

    1. 完全备份(Full Backup):完全备份是指将数据库的所有数据和结构都备份到备份文件中。这种备份方式最为简单和全面,但备份时间和备份文件的大小较大。

    2. 增量备份(Incremental Backup):增量备份是指只备份自上次完全备份或增量备份以来发生变化的数据。这种备份方式可以减少备份时间和备份文件的大小,但恢复数据时需要依次恢复完全备份和增量备份。

    3. 差异备份(Differential Backup):差异备份是指只备份自上次完全备份以来发生变化的数据。与增量备份不同的是,差异备份只备份自上次完全备份以来的变化数据,而不是自上次备份以来的所有变化数据。这种备份方式介于完全备份和增量备份之间,可以减少备份时间和备份文件的大小,但恢复数据时只需恢复完全备份和最近的差异备份。

    二、备份数据库的操作流程

    1. 确定备份策略:根据业务需求和数据重要性,确定备份频率、备份方式和备份存储位置。一般来说,重要数据建议进行定期的完全备份,并根据需求选择增量备份或差异备份。

    2. 配置备份工具:选择适合的备份工具,并根据数据库类型和版本进行配置。常用的数据库备份工具有MySQL的mysqldump命令和Percona XtraBackup,Oracle的RMAN命令,SQL Server的SQL Server Management Studio等。

    3. 执行备份操作:根据配置的备份策略,执行备份操作。一般来说,完全备份会比较耗时,所以可以选择在业务低峰期进行。增量备份和差异备份可以选择在每天的固定时间执行。

    4. 验证备份文件:备份完成后,需要验证备份文件的完整性和可用性。可以通过恢复备份文件到另一个环境进行验证,或使用备份工具提供的验证功能。

    5. 存储备份文件:备份文件需要存储在安全可靠的位置,以防止数据丢失。可以选择本地存储、网络存储、云存储等方式进行备份文件的存储。

    6. 定期检查和更新备份策略:备份策略应定期进行检查和更新,以适应业务需求的变化和数据库的变化。同时,还需要定期测试和恢复备份数据,以确保备份文件的可用性和恢复过程的正确性。

    总结:备份数据库是一项重要的数据管理工作,可以保护数据免受意外损坏和丢失。通过选择合适的备份方法和执行备份操作流程,可以确保数据的安全和可靠性。同时,备份策略的定期检查和更新也是必不可少的,以适应业务需求和数据库变化的不断发展。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部